Everton return to Premier League action as they face West Ham United, following a tough week for the club. They aim to bounce back from their controversial Merseyside derby defeat and secure a positive result against David Moyes' side.
Everton return to Premier League action today when they make the trip to the London Stadium to take on West Ham United.
